I am going to Tokyo in late May, early June and i was reading about the rainy season and the golden week holiday period. I was just wondering whether the early June time is a good time to go, would the rain really spoil my time there or stop me from going shopping, sight seeing etc?
Lots of shopping areas in Japan have covered walkways, and just carry a collapsible umbrella with you for the times you need it. If you don't let the rain stop you, it won't.
